Prison Dream Meaning

A dream of walls, bars or confinement pointing to felt limits—external restrictions, internal rules, or the part of you that feels boxed in.

Symbol Combos

  • Prison + Key: Access to a solution or inner resource you already possess.
  • Prison + Window: An invitation to new perspective or an emotional outlet to be used.
  • Prison + Guards/Warden: Authority figures or internalized rules policing your behavior.
  • Prison + Tunnel/Stairs: A difficult but possible path to liberation; slow ascent over rash escape.
